I believe the idea is that the battery will die from other causes before it is necessary to add water. In any case, do not add acid to the battery, just water.Thanks. One thing I have found is that the moniker "maintenance free" on a traditional lead-acid battery is a lie.
The battery must vent and in turn, will lose the amount of electrolyte mixture through charge cycles.
So while old batteries had fill caps on top that were easily accessed and filled, the new ones are hidden under the sticker.
You won't even know they are there unless you go looking for them.
And they are pushed in flush. You have to pick them out with a knife or pick to check the levels and fill if necessary.
I pulled mine about 2 years ago and found all cells low a significant amount. Filled to correct level and still using.
It's kind of like not putting dipsticks in engines and transmissions, labeling them "maintenance free" or "lifetime fluid".
None of it is true. What it really is-is "maintenance discouraged" for premature failure.
